File tree 1 file changed +6
-12
lines changed 1 file changed +6
-12
lines changed Original file line number Diff line number Diff line change @@ -383,29 +383,23 @@ describe('TypeScript', () => {
383
383
// Type-only imports were added in TypeScript ESTree 2.23.0
384
384
. filter ( ( parser ) => parser !== require . resolve ( 'typescript-eslint-parser' ) )
385
385
. forEach ( ( parser ) => {
386
- const parserConfig = {
387
- parser,
388
- settings : {
389
- 'import/parsers' : { [ parser ] : [ '.ts' ] } ,
390
- 'import/resolver' : { 'eslint-import-resolver-typescript' : true } ,
391
- } ,
392
- } ;
393
-
394
386
ruleTester . run ( 'no-extraneous-dependencies' , rule , {
395
387
valid : [
396
- test ( Object . assign ( {
388
+ test ( {
397
389
code : 'import type T from "a";' ,
398
390
options : [ { packageDir : packageDirWithTypescriptDevDependencies , devDependencies : false } ] ,
399
- } , parserConfig ) ) ,
391
+ parser,
392
+ } ) ,
400
393
] ,
401
394
invalid : [
402
- test ( Object . assign ( {
395
+ test ( {
403
396
code : 'import T from "a";' ,
404
397
options : [ { packageDir : packageDirWithTypescriptDevDependencies , devDependencies : false } ] ,
405
398
errors : [ {
406
399
message : "'a' should be listed in the project's dependencies, not devDependencies." ,
407
400
} ] ,
408
- } , parserConfig ) ) ,
401
+ parser,
402
+ } ) ,
409
403
] ,
410
404
} ) ;
411
405
} ) ;
You can’t perform that action at this time.
0 commit comments